1. What is Shanghai Qing?

Shanghai green is a green vegetable. It looks similar to rapeseed and should be considered a variant of rapeseed. It is a kind of cruciferous plant and can be purchased in the market all year round. Shanghai green is rich in nutrients, containing a large amount of carbohydrates and crude fiber as well as a variety of mineral trace elements and vitamins. People can regulate their stomachs, protect blood vessels, and protect human skin and eyes after eating it.

3. Shanghai Qing can prevent intestinal diseases

The crude fiber and carbohydrates contained in Shanghai Qing can speed up intestinal peristalsis and promote stool formation and excretion after entering the human body. It can effectively prevent and relieve constipation. At the same time, it can also clean up a variety of pathogens in the intestines, and it also has a good preventive effect on the common enteritis and diarrhea in humans.
